What is a Warp Core?
The term “Warp Core” refers to a crucial component in the realm of science fiction, particularly within the context of space travel and advanced propulsion systems. In various narratives, especially in the Star Trek universe, the Warp Core is depicted as the heart of a starship’s warp drive, enabling faster-than-light travel. This technology is often portrayed as a fusion reactor, harnessing immense energy to create a warp field around the vessel, allowing it to traverse vast distances in space.
Functionality of the Warp Core
The primary function of a Warp Core is to generate the necessary power to facilitate warp speed. This is achieved through a process known as matter-antimatter annihilation, where matter and antimatter collide, resulting in a massive energy release. The Warp Core converts this energy into a warp field, which distorts space-time, allowing the starship to move beyond the speed of light. This intricate process is essential for interstellar travel, making the Warp Core a pivotal element in the narrative of space exploration.
Components of a Warp Core
A typical Warp Core consists of several key components, including the matter and antimatter injectors, the reaction chamber, and the dilithium crystals. The injectors are responsible for introducing matter and antimatter into the reaction chamber, where they interact to produce energy. Dilithium crystals play a critical role in regulating this reaction, ensuring that the energy output is stable and manageable. The design and efficiency of these components are often central to the plotlines involving starship operations.
Safety Protocols and Risks
Given the immense power generated by a Warp Core, safety protocols are paramount. In many stories, the failure of a Warp Core can lead to catastrophic consequences, including warp core breaches that can destroy the starship and endanger its crew. As a result, starship crews are trained to monitor the Warp Core’s status continuously and implement emergency procedures if anomalies are detected. These safety measures add tension and drama to the narrative, highlighting the dangers of advanced technology.
